How to Weatherstrip a Door
April 29, 2010Adding weatherstripping to a door will reduce your energy bills.
Step1:The first step is to determine if you need to replace old/torn weather stripping or are adding weather-stripping where there has never been any. New homes likely have weather-stripping and the door frame will have a slot for built in weather-stripping. (see pic). Older homes will likely have none.
Step2:Adding weather stripping to a door in an older home requires three steps: (1) adding weather-stripping to the bottom of the door, (2) adding weather-stripping to the door frame and (3) by adjusting the door to close properly.
1. Major home improvement stores sell bottom weather-stripping (white or brown) that installs easily and is adjustable for height over about a 1/4″ range.
-If you live in a newer home then you can adjust threshold height by using a screwdriver on the Phillips head screws embedded. Turning the screw right-or tightening- raises height and turning left lowers the threshold.
Step 3:Installing weather-stripping on the door frame requires you to measure the gap between the door and frame and choose a weather-stripping slightly thicker. (Tip-get “high compression” foam-this foam compresses easily and fills uneven gaps better). If adding weather-stripping where none has been it is important to install it on the correct surface of the door frame (not the door). There are three sides to install the weather stripping: the door frame where the door striker is, the top frame and the frame where the door hinges are. On the top frame and the frame that has the door striker (non-hinge side) the weather-stripping should be added to the surface that faces you as you open the door. On the door frame hinge side the weather-stripping should be placed on the surface that faces you if you are standing in the door frame looking at the hinges (see pic).
-Newer homes have built in weather-stripping that you simply push into a slot and is very easily replaced.
Step 4: After installing the weather-stripping you can adjust slightly for fit by adjusting the door latch striker plate.

How to Remove Door Weatherstripping
April 28, 2010If you feel a draft, it’s more than likely that you need to replace the felt or sweep weatherstripping installed around your doors. But, before you do this, you need to remove the old Weatherstripping , which may be worn and ineffective.
- Open or remove the door by taking it off its hinges so it doesn’t interfere with your work. You may not need to remove the door if there’s no weatherstripping attached to it or on the top and bottom of the entryway.
- Step 2
Locate the old weatherstripping, which should be attached to the side of the entrance where the door makes contact with the door jamb. There may also be weatherstripping attached to the top and bottom of the door.
- Step 3
Insert the prybar under the weatherstripping by gently tapping it with a hammer until it’s securely in place.
- Step 4
Pull the prybar toward you, removing the old weatherstripping, working from the top of the entryway to the bottom. If necessary, work your way around the whole door. You can also use the claw end of the hammer, once you’ve begun the process.
- Step 5
Remove the weatherstripping(Weather strip) from the top and bottom of the door using a screwdriver. This type of weatherstripping, known as a “sweep strip,” is usually fastened to the door by several screws.
- Step 6
Clean up all debris, making sure there are no remnants of the old Weather strip attached to the entryway.
How to Install Weather Strip
April 27, 2010Weather strip around doors and windows can be a low-cost way to stop drafts and to cut down on heating and cooling loss. We’ll help you seal down the right choices.
Understand different kinds of stripping: compression strips; tubular gaskets; adhesive-backed V strips that can be cut with scissors or a utility knife; magnetic weather stripp for metal- or steel-clad doors.
Measure the length of all seams to be weather-stripped, add a couple of inches for each seam and add the numbers together.
Cut the Weather Strip to fit each seam, plus extra. Apply the stripping all the way around a window by using nails, screws or adhesive. Attach the stripping to the jamb or the stop (depending on the kind of stripping you get).
Apply the Weatherstripping to the sides and the tops of doors. Use a weather-tight threshold or door sweep to seal the bottom. (A door sweep is a metal or wood bracket with a plastic or vinyl flap that hangs to the floor to stop airflow.)

How Can Your Business Benefit From Fast Paced rapid prototype
April 22, 2010
Simply put, a rapid prototyping process is a procedure or method wherein a design is tested during the early parts of its development.
This type has been proven to be more useful in projects that involve large-scale designs. From the name, rapid prototyping involves quickly constructing a scale down model of large objects through the aid of computerized three dimensional images.
These virtual designs are broken into parts or cross sections which identically represents the actual object. When building the prototype, a machine will read the information from the computer and would construct the images segment by segment until the whole prototype has been created.
Depending on the type of the rapid prototype machines and the models size, constructing a prototype using the rapid prototyping process may take from 3 to more than 70 hours. Others even take months to complete.Usually CAD is used to construct the virtual model which later on is converted to the STL file format. A rapid prototype machine then processes the .STL file and creates layers of the model.
Layer upon layer, the segments are piled on top of each other until the model is created. These layers are glued together by using lasers. These layers are made of either liquid or powdered materials. Afterwards, when all the layers have been laid down, the superstructure of the model is removed revealing the unpolished surfaces of the prototype. The prototype model is then cleaned.
A lot of companies prefer using rapid prototype because it offers the best benefits to them. Using rapid prototyping processes increase effective communication, decrease development time, reduce the prevalence of costly mistakes, lessen any sustaining engineering changes, and help extends product life through the addition of essential features and remove unneeded features during the early developments of the design.
By allowing engineers, manufacturers and even the marketing and purchasing people take a look at the product during the onset of its development they can identify and correct mistakes while it is still cheaper to do so.
Among the types of rapid prototyping processes include stereolithography, selective laser sinthering, laminated object manufacturing, solid ground curing and rapid tooling. The standard interface between CAD software and rapid prototyping machines is the STL file format.
MacroMind Director (MMD) is another type of prototyping tool which combines a text, graphics, animation as well as music and other sound, and video. This type of tool has been used more commonly in film, engineering, education and business industries. Most of the output is simulations, visualizations and presentations.
Rapid prototyping, otherwise known as desktop manufacturing, additive fabrication, solid freeform fabrication, three dimensional printing or layered manufacturing, has always been in the forefront of development and design. By quickly creating prototypes that are similar to form and function as the actual production unit, developers are able to create a product that meets the expectations of consumers and project sponsors.
Through a combination of rapid prototyping methods and traditional model making, high quality prototypes can be created with less the expense and quicker turnaround times.
Compared to traditional fabrication methods like milling and turning, rapid prototyping is way better in terms of accuracy, speed and quality. By using rapid prototyping techniques complex and intricate shapes can be formed without any complicated machine setup, prototypes can be created from different types of materials or composites, and the process simplifies the whole process of creating a prototype.
Because of the advantage it brings, rapid prototyping services are being offered by companies to engineers and system developers to better understand their product and communicate better with their target clientele. Not only does the technique used by designers, developers and manufacturers, but professions like surgeons, architects, artists and even mere individuals regularly utilize the technology.
Among the services being offered are stereolithography, selective laser sintering or SLS, fused deposition modeling of FDM, laminated object manufacturing or LOM, inkjet-based systems and three dimensional printing or 3DP.
SLS is one of the most used tools in rapid prototyping techniques. In SLS rapid prototyping, a CO2 laser is used to melt powdered thermoplastic materials to create layers. A scanner guides the laser and melts specific areas and materials based on the information fed by the 3D CAD.
Prototypes created from SLS processes are strong and more tolerant to stress. Materials used in the market include DuraForm, CastForm, Somos 201, FR85A and LaserForm. Most of the prototypes created from these materials are usually ready to be used and only require minimal clean up and finishing.
Stereolithography or SLA creates prototype part layers through the use of a solid-state laser. The 3D CAD data guides the laser as it cuts through the surface of a container which normally contains liquid photopolymer material.
In LOM, on the other hand, uses a paper sheet with one side laminated with adhesive. The laser cuts the outline on the paper sheet. This process does not involve any chemical reaction which makes it cheaper and large plastic mold parts can be made.

A Day Of A Plastic Mold Maker’s Life
April 19, 2010What Is It Like To Be A plastic mold Maker?
Ok, raise your hand if you personally know a plastic mold maker, hmmm… I don’t see any hands up! Well, who knows what a mold maker does? This doesn’t look good, so I will try to give you a little insight into this unknown world.
I have one of those “invisible jobs” that is seldom recognized, but universally valued. You see, almost everyone likes using their cell phone, computer, driving their car, playing CD’s, and generally enjoying the fruit of all our hard work.
Yet, almost nobody ever thinks about where all this stuff comes from. In fact, I’ve been asked some very strange questions over the years about what I do, such as when my own mother asked me how many molds I made a day! I told her it takes anywhere from 4-12 weeks to make a typical mold and she just sort of cocked her head and replied, ‘Oh.”
Let’s just take your computer mouse for example. It is entirely made of plastic, and it took a mold maker to make the mold to make the mouse components. I am guessing that there are 10 pieces altogether in the mouse, so that means 10 different molds had to be made. Here is a little view into a typical day of an American plastic mold maker. It doesn’t really vary too much around the world either, just in the details and amount of overtime and specialization.
He, (I’ve never seen a she, though I heard about one once) starts work at either 6 or 7 a.m. I also have never known a mold maker who started later on a regular basis. He typically works a 9 or 10 hour day and often 5 hours on Saturday. Before Asia became a mold making force to be reckoned with, there was basically unlimited overtime for everyone.
He has likely been in plastic mold making for over 25 years, had two years of technical school, and worked as an apprentice for 4 years. That is a lot of training and experience, which is quite necessary because there is so much to know and master.
Here is the process in a nutshell, a small nutshell
Once somebody comes up with the idea to make the computer mouse, he gets a preliminary product design made, then a mold making company is contracted to build the mold, a mold designer comes up with a “blueprint” (nobody uses blueprints anymore, it is called CAD because it is done on a computer), and finally the mouse gets molded into the plastic part.
So, the mold maker gets the plan from the mold designer and together they come up with a “how to” procedure. The entire mold is gone over in every minute detail because, in the end, a mold a really a million little details that fit together.
So, for the next month or two, the mold maker works together with machinists, apprentices, and other mold maker to fabricate all the shapes and pieces that comprise a finished mold. They need to cut steel with special cutters on very sophisticated machinery that can easily cost $150,000.00 each.
Then there is the very mysterious machine called an electrical discharge machine that is truly strange to the initiated. This machine, which goes by the name of EDM, is the main way that all these shapes are produced in the plastic parts you use, such as the curvy mouse.
The EDM is a bit like sinking your fist into a ball of dough and leaving the imprint of you fist in the dough. Only the dough is hardened steel and your fist would be some graphite, (like pencil lead) made in the shape of the mouse. The EDM produces whatever shape you can make in the graphite into the steel.
So, the mold maker gets the steel with the shapes, and puts them in a holder (mold base), and makes everything fit perfectly so the plastic part comes out nice and clean. If he does a poor job, you will see the little ugly lines on the part, or little fins of plastic sticking out, like you might see on a cheap Chinese toy.
Did I bore you yet?
One thing people don’t seem to understand is that all these pieces have to fit together like a puzzle, only the gaps cannot be more than about one-eighth of a hair (.0005 in.). This isn’t so difficult, until the shapes are on angles or have weird radii that are very complicated to produce and measure.
In a typical day he might run a surface grinding machine, a CNC milling machine, do some EDM machining, polish by hand, fit the pieces together, analyze everything on his computer and try to keep track of the various projects he is responsible for. Often one mold maker runs several jobs simultaneously and has highly skilled specialists working a bit like sub-contractors in the same shop.
When the mold is finished, it goes to the injection molder, who will put it in an injection molding machine for sampling. This is always a nerve-wracking experience because you are never really 100% certain that everything is correct.
Hopefully, the part runs well, is the right shape and size, has the right finish and is free from defects. Sometimes it is a complete disaster. Maybe he overlooked something important, maybe the design was flawed, maybe he just made a mistake in interpreting the plan, things can and do happen! This is where Murphy’s Law is most applicable!
If the part is good, he might get an “attaboy”, often nothing is said. If it’s bad, he will certainly hear about it! Generally though, most companies treat mold makers with at least a little respect. The worst is when the boss is from an accounting background or has an MBA. They have no clue as to what it takes to actually make a mold, to them it is about numbers and more numbers. When the boss is from a manufacturing background he has been there and felt the dread of a scrapped $10,000 piece of steel.

Types of Weather Stripping
April 12, 2010How many winters are you going to have to wear sweatshirts and other heavy clothing just so you can watch the television in your own living room without freezing? On the other end of the spectrum, how many summers are you going to roast because the air conditioner is broken; or just too expensive to use? There might be a simple solution to both of these problems. No, it is not to commit to installing a house full of new energy efficient windows; the inexpensive way out is to adequately weather strip your existing windows.
Fortunately, there are a variety of products that are available today. At least one of them should be an ideal match for your particular situation. First of all, there is reinforced felt that contains a metal piece that is pliable enough to conform to any type of window that you may have. The V-shape vinyl strip is known to be a super insulating device. It is self sticking, durable and will last a very long time. It is easy to install also; simply measure, cut, peel and stick to any clean surface. Another popular weather stripping choice is the tube gasket that is attached to a rigid piece of metal. This particular type is very effective in filling any voids around windows or doors. It has been known to last from five to ten years.
Remember, when using self stick products, none of them will stick to a surface that has not been thoroughly cleaned. Trying to do so will result in an ineffective seal, thereby defeating the whole purpose of weather stripping. Therefore, if you want a very positive result for your time, energy and money be absolutely sure to prepare the surface by over cleaning it. Nothing is more disheartening than to expend a lot of energy on a weather stripping project; only to see it peel off a short time later.

Candle Making Plastic Mold - Candles For All Occasions
April 1, 2010When it comes to candle making, molds are obviously a very important component. Without a mold, it will be extremely difficult to make a candle. Their job is to give your candle support and shape. Needless to say like everything, there are endless shapes and also different types of molds made out of different materials, including plastic, metal, rubber, glass and even wooden.
Plastic molds are probably best if you are a beginner as they are durable, so you don’t have to be concerned with damaging the mold. Unfortunately they do not last as long, however they are great to practice on. Metal molds are quite popular, last much longer than plastic and don’t have the seam that other molds have, eliminating the need to trim the wax. Perhaps the only disadvantage to metal molds is that the wax tends to stick, making cleaning them a bit more tedious.
Rubber candle molds are becoming very popular and they come in a range of different materials, being latex, polyurethane and silicone. These molds are for the more advanced candle makers. Due to their flexibility you can make many different shapes but you need to take care when you are pouring hot wax that the shape you desire is not lost. They are very durable and tend to stretch quite well making it easier to remove your candle once cooled. Although they cost more than plastic or metal molds there are lots of advantages to using rubber candle molds.
The styles of candle rapid prototype are endless. Whatever shape you desire you can probably buy it. Tea lights are extremely popular these days are usually mass produced in round shapes, however there are many more exciting shapes to be made such as: hearts, flowers, balls - as long as it floats, you are only limited by your imagination. Tea lights, also used to heat fondues, have become hugely popular as table decorations in recent times for subtle lighting.
If you desire to make a certain style of candle and cannot find a plastic mold to suit, why not make your own. If you have a container that is clean, has no rust, is leak proof, can stand very hot temperature and you can release the candle when it’s cooled, then you may be able to make your own. Glass is a perfect mold for making gel candles, and there are many different glass molds to choose from. Glass is great due to the fact that the candle is easily removed, however do take care when pouring the hot wax as finer glass is prone to breakages. Gel candles do not have to be removed making wine glasses and different glass shapes ideal. There are all sorts of different shapes to make candles from, some being:
